				I am using the example files supplied with PICC with one single 
 
modification.  I changed the 16MHZ oscillator to 8MHZ in each file then 
 
compiled  ex_bootloader.c and programmed it into the 45K22.
 
 
I then compiled the second (ex_bootload.c) file.  After I confirmed the
 
 45K22 came up with the "Waiting for Download" prompt I used the SIOW to 
 
download the compiled ex_bootload.hex file to the 45K22 and it worked first 
 
time. 
 
 
I noticed both files have 2014 copyrights on them indicating they were 
 
changed this year. 
 
 
Unfortunately you will have to ask CCS for an updated copy. It is a 
 
violation of the CCS copyright for me to provide it.   Being a registered

Thanks for the reply.
 
I have figured out that the problem was with the flow control. Enabling the transmission delay to 2ms/char in Tera Term fixes the problem. |
